Sault Tribe Youth Education runs the Youth Education and Activities (YEA) program for tribal youth, with a St. Ignace site based at LaSalle Middle School and a YEA summer program offered together with local schools. The Sault Ste. Marie Tribe of Chippewa Indians also administers a Youth Development Fund that reimburses families up to $250 a year toward camps, classes, cultural trips, sports fees, music, dance and regalia, and runs a Summer Youth Employment program for Native American youth ages 14-24 across a seven-county service area. Program hours, camper ages and summer activity details are not published for the St. Ignace youth site.
